Real meat's texture comes from two separate things: the aligned muscle fiber structure that gives it bite and directionality, and the moisture and fat held within that cellular structure that release as juiciness when you chew. Plant-based analogs recreate the first through extrusion — high heat, pressure, and shear align plant proteins, usually soy or pea, into a fibrous structure that mimics muscle fiber. Guar gum's role is on the second half of that equation: holding moisture within the extruded structure so it doesn't dry out during processing, freezing, and cooking, and helping keep the fat phase stable within the matrix so it releases as juiciness on the bite rather than leaking out before the product even reaches the pan. Typical dosage ranges from 0.2–0.8%, adjustable to the specific analog format and cooking method you're formulating for.
Key Benefits
Meat-Like Bite
Builds fibrous chew resistance that mimics the bite of muscle tissue in plant-based meat analogs.
Juiciness
Retains cooking liquid within the product structure, so plant-based analogs release juice on the bite rather than eating dry.
Firmness Control
Tunable gel firmness lets formulators dial in a texture that matches the specific meat product being replicated.
Extrusion Moisture Retention
Supports moisture retention through the high-heat, high-shear extrusion process that gives plant proteins their fibrous, meat-like structure — the same intense processing that builds the fiber alignment also drives moisture out, and guar gum's water-binding helps offset that loss.
Cook Yield & Shrinkage Control
Manages how much moisture the product loses and how much it shrinks during cooking, mimicking the realistic textural change real meat undergoes on the grill or in the pan, without drying out excessively.
Fat Encapsulation & Marbling Stability
Helps keep the fat phase stable within the protein matrix through high-heat cooking, so it releases as juiciness on the bite rather than leaking out of the product before it's even finished cooking.
Freeze-Thaw Stability for Frozen Analogs
Maintains texture through freezing and thawing — the format most plant-based meat analogs are actually sold and stored in — rather than only performing well on a freshly formed, unfrozen sample.
Green Strength (Pre-Cook Structural Integrity)
Holds the raw, uncooked product together through forming, packaging, freezing, and distribution — the product needs to survive that entire journey intact before the consumer ever puts it in a pan.

Formulation Guidance
Add guar gum to the protein pre-mix before it goes through the extruder, rather than post-extrusion — this ensures even distribution through the high-shear, high-heat extrusion process, where achieving uniform distribution afterward is much harder to control.
Dosage is worth tuning to your product's typical cooking method rather than using one setting across your whole range: products intended mainly for high-heat, fast cooking (grilling, pan-searing) lose moisture faster than those cooked by gentler methods (baking, steaming), so a dosage calibrated for oven preparation may dry out faster on a grill.
Because most meat analogs are sold frozen and go through a full freeze-thaw-and-cook cycle before consumption, evaluate final texture after that complete cycle rather than immediately after forming or extrusion — a product that has excellent bite and juiciness right off the line can perform differently once it's been frozen, thawed, and cooked the way a consumer actually would.
